If I had told you this morning to pick up Raiders QB Bruce Gradkowski and start him over Colts QB Peyton Manning, you would have thought I was crazy.
Crazy like a fox!
Gradkowski scored 32 fantasy points in the Raiders’ shocking 27-24 win over the Steelers.
No that’s not a misprint, Bruce Gradkowski scored 32 fantasy points. Really. He completed 20 of 33 passes for 308 yards with three touchdowns and no interceptions. That’s twice as many as Manning, who finished with a mediocre 16 points.
That’s right, Gradkowski scored twice as many fantasy points than Peyton Manning.
Oh, and the madness doesn’t end there.
Raiders WR Louis Murphy posted 24 fantasy points, with four receptions for 128 yards and two touchdowns. That’s the same Murphy who was owned in four percent of NFL.com leagues. Oh, and guess who Murphy outscored?
You guessed it.
Murphy scored more fantasy points than Reggie Wayne. And Randy Moss. And Andre Johnson. And just about every other wide receiver in the league.
